Setting Up the SQL Query Engine After Upgrading SQL Server

When SQL Server 2025 is installed together with GENESIS and the SQL Query Engine, it is automatically configured to use the SQL Query Engine. However, if you upgrade an existing SQL Server instance to SQL Server 2025, you must perform some additional steps before the SQL Query Engine can be used.

Before enabling the SQL Query Engine on an upgraded SQL Server instance, verify the following:

  • An existing SQL Server instance has been upgraded to SQL Server 2025.

  • You have administrative rights on the machine where SQL Server is running, so that you can add features and run the Configure System application.

To enable the SQL Query Engine on an upgraded SQL Server:

  1. Run the SQL Server 2025 installation application. You can use an installer available from Microsoft, or use the installer found on the GENESIS ISO after mounting it, under \Dependencies\SQLEXPRx64ENU.exe.

  2. In the Installation Center, select New SQL Server standalone installation or add features to an existing installation.

  3. Continue through the setup prompts. On the Installation Type page, click Add features to an existing instance of SQL Server 2025 and select the desired instance.

  4. Continue through the setup prompts. On the Feature Selection page, select the AI Services and Language Extensions check box.

  5. Continue through the setup and allow it to complete the additional feature installation.

  6. In the Windows Start menu, expand GENESIS Tools and open the Configure System application. Proceed through the steps to allow it to configure and install the necessary SQL Query Engine components.
